Would expect re-shaping the prospect system will go deeper than just a few ELC's. Aside from Chas Sharpe, who signed for 2yrs anyways, not many of the AHL signings have had the greatest years and could conceivably move on. Wouldn't be shocked if a few of the '03's pivot to USports now that that option opened up. None of the pure AHL contract rotation guys have stood out and most of the Cyclones on AHL deals are in the same boat, aside from Sharpe as mentioned. Barbolini and Parsons also signed for 2ys, but I could see Stevens, Gosselin, Frasca, Sikic, and McCleary being one-and-done and maybe some AHL signed depth like Mastrosimone, Solow, and Miller move on after a few years here - and this is before getting into NHL contract turnover.

I bet we see a lot of new AHL signings to fill out the Marlies and Cyclones too - as many as 8-10 total at any positions.

ASU is a team with a few solid 5th year options - Sillinger, Schlaine, Beck, Jackson Twins for AHL deals.

I'd say it's more ideal if these AHL signings are at oldest 01's just so they have a bit of rope to develop through the ECHL and AHL, but a few may be '99 and '00 just to fill rosters out.
